1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The banning of dangerous goods such as asbestos is due to
Back
legal regulations.
Answer explanation
The banning of dangerous goods like asbestos is primarily due to legal regulations aimed at protecting public health and safety, making 'legal regulations' the correct choice.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A government is providing businesses with a tax benefit if they source their electricity through renewable energy sources. The most likely reason for offering this tax benefit is to
Back
encourage businesses to be more environmentally sustainable.
Answer explanation
The tax benefit aims to promote the use of renewable energy, encouraging businesses to adopt environmentally sustainable practices, which aligns with government goals for sustainability.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
An employee has badly injured their shoulder at work and is seeing a physiotherapist for treatment. The treatment that the physiotherapist provides can be described as a
Back
customised service.
Answer explanation
The physiotherapist's treatment is tailored to the specific needs of the injured employee, making it a customised service. Unlike standardised services, customised services are designed to meet individual requirements.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The role of an operations manager is to
Back
reduce waste and increase efficiency.
Answer explanation
The role of an operations manager primarily focuses on reducing waste and increasing efficiency in processes, which enhances productivity and optimizes resource use, making this the correct choice.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Common characteristics of a critical path analysis?
Back
What tasks need to be done, how long they take, what order is necessary
Answer explanation
The correct choice highlights essential aspects of critical path analysis: identifying necessary tasks, their durations, and the order in which they must be completed to ensure timely project delivery.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A florist designs floral displays for weddings to suit the colour preferences of individual couples. What is the main performance objective being targeted?
Back
Customisation
Answer explanation
The florist's focus on designing floral displays to match individual couples' color preferences highlights the importance of customisation, making it the main performance objective targeted.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The training of staff in the manufacturing process is an example of interdependence between which business functions?
Back
Operations and human resources
Answer explanation
The training of staff is a key function of human resources, ensuring employees are skilled for operations. This highlights the interdependence between operations and human resources in the manufacturing process.
